As the Lead Pharmacist Paediatrics (P3) you are responsible for providing leadership to a team delivering comprehensive clinical pharmacy services to paediatric wards and the Neonatal Intensive Care Unit (NICU) at the Royal Darwin and Palmerston Hospitals.

Your key duties will include planning and implementing specialist clinical pharmacy services, providing specialist clinical advice to medical and nursing staff, and leading quality improvement activities related to medication management within paediatric services. In addition, you will develop, implement and maintain clinical guidelines to support best practice, and maintain contemporary pharmacy practice knowledge through structured professional development activities.

Contributing to the weekend and on-call roster and being available for out of hours emergency duties is essential.

To be shortlisted, you require tertiary qualifications in Pharmacy, eligibility for registration as a pharmacist with the Pharmacy Board of Australia, and have extensive clinical pharmacy experience, preferably in Paediatric Medicine.

Your expertise in quality improvement principles and medication safety standards, and ability to plan and prioritise high volume complex workload will be key to your success. High level communication, interpersonal and conflict management skills along with a demonstrated awareness and understanding of Aboriginal culture and interacting with patients and families of diverse cultural and social backgrounds is essential.
